VenoStent - About the company

VenoStent is a series A company based in Nashville (United States), founded in 2017. It operates as a Developer of a shape memory polymer stent for vascular surgery. VenoStent has raised $33.4M in funding from investors like Good Growth Capital, IAG Capital Partners and Y Combinator. The company has 7 active competitors, including 2 funded and 2 that have exited. Its top competitors include companies like Invizius, Redsense Medical and Doto Medical.

Company Details

Developer of a shape memory polymer stent for vascular surgery. The SelfWrap, is an external stent, used for venous access in hemodialysis patients. The stent, is a polymer wrap, provides a mechanical support and reduces vein collapse, at the point of surgery, by promoting vein growth in dialysis patients.
